What's probably happened is that Michael Berryman may have spoken before he should have. He's probably recorded a commentary track, but Anchor Bay is likely still doing all the legal work before they can "officially" announce the title.
That kind of thing happens a lot. The DVD companies usually err on the side of caution, 'cause you look REAL stupid when you can't release a title you already announced. So the companies now are completely silent until right about the time the discs are ready to be sent out.
They're just trying to avoid something like the last minute cancellation of The Tenant. In other words, this is probably gonna happen, we'll hear something from AB in the near future. Of course, Mike spilling the beans a little sooner may force AB to make an announcement earlier than they planned.
